Equipment / Media NeededVideo - Camcorder

Firewire or USBiSight CameraCablesMedia - DV, 8 mm, HardDrive, DVD

AppsiMovie, MovieMaker, Jumpcut (Web 2.0 app)

Digital Camera - Still ImagesCables / Card ReaderDigital Cards and Lingo - SD, Memory Stick

Microphone (Built in or External)Hard Drive Space - Possibly External Drive

1 hour = 13 GB / 1 minute = 200 MB

TripodProduction Media

DVDs / CDs

Budget

Digital Camcorder = $250 / Free

Digital Camera = $150 / Free

Microphone - $30 / Free

External Hard Drive = $100

Tripod - Donation up to $30

Tapes, Media Cards, Readers = $100

Look for Mini-Grants around $500 for 1 station
